House rent exploits
Called business enterprises
Draining the tenant’s income
In cyclical repayments
Turned sour upon demand
Merchant vessels perished
In service stormy seas
Landlord calls in due course
Heartbeat of renter skipped
Ran in fear, like Adam of old
On hearing the voice of God
Looked for where to hide
Lest he be driven out of Eden
These rented houses, where I live
Are like traps set for city dwellers
